http://blog.csdn.net/hbsong75/article/details/9293773

QT与Java有点类似,也是一种跨平台的软件(当然在windows平台和Linux平台需要安装相应的QT开发环境和运行库,类似于JAVA在不同平台下的虚拟机JVM环境),因此对于某些需要同时支持windows平台和linux平台的应用,QT也是一种不错的选择。

QT在linux的开发环境相对简单,只要下载一个Qtcreator就可以轻松搞定:http://qt-project.org/downloads。

而对于Windows下熟悉VS开发的程序员来说,如何将QT与VS结合来开发需要遵循一定的步骤,下面以VS2010下集成QT4.8来做一说明:

1.        下载windows下的QT库:http://download.qt-project.org/official_releases/qt/4.8/4.8.5/qt-win-opensource-4.8.5-vs2010.exe;

2.        下载VS2010 下的QT插件:

http://download.qt-project.org/official_releases/vsaddin/qt-vs-addin-1.1.11-opensource.exe

3.        安装VS2010,此步骤略;

4.        安装QT库:执行qt-win-opensource-4.8.5-vs2010.exe;

这个安装时间比较长,需要一点耐心,要安装的小文件实在太多了!

5.        安装QT插件:执行qt-vs-addin-1.1.11-opensource.exe

6.        启动 VS2010,选择 File -> New -> Project,出来的对话框中第一个就是QTProject选择。

注意:

1. QT库需要先装,然后再装插件,因为装插件的过程中会自动检测QT库,并且在VS2010的环境中做好自动设置,省去了很多手工设置的麻烦;

2. 如果是老的QT版本移植过来,可能会报“There's noQt version assigned to this project for platform Win32.Please use the 'changeQt version' feature and choose a valid Qt version for this platform.”错误,修复的方法是鼠标右击工程,在弹出右键菜单中找到“Qt Project Settings”,将Version设置为当前的Qt version即可。

转载于:https://www.cnblogs.com/jukan/p/5981792.html

VS2010与QT的集成开发环境相关推荐

  1. 搭建QT和VS2010集成开发环境

    转载请注明出处:http://blog.csdn.net/xiaowei_cqu/article/details/7330759 在网上搜了各种教程,(尤其是这篇各种转载http://tech.tec ...

  2. Qt在linux下无法输入中文,Ubuntu使用集成开发环境QT无法输入中文的解决方法

    QT Creator是轻量级集成开发环境,在Ubuntu系统操作中,使用QT时无法输入中文,遇到这种情况要如何处理呢?下面小编就给大家介绍下Ubuntu如何解决QT无法输入中文问题. 1 安装搜狗输入 ...

  3. 10 个免费的 C/C++ 集成开发环境

    http://cnbeta.com/articles/188721.htm 集成开发环境(IDE)可以给程序员提供很大的帮助.大多数的IDE包含编译器和解释器.例如微软的 Visual Studio ...

  4. linux集成开发环境

    Linux操作系统的种种集成开发环境 随着Linux的逐渐兴起,已经有为数众多的程序在上面驰骋了,许多开发环境(Development Environment)也应运而生.好的开发环境一定是集成了编辑 ...

  5. Linux软件集成开发环境

    package: download from: 软件集成开发环境(代码编辑.浏览.编译.调试) Emacs http://www.gnu.org/software/emacs/ Source-Navi ...

  6. 关于初学者用哪种C/C++编译器(集成开发环境)的问题

    [原创]关于初学者用哪种C/C++编译器(集成开发环境)的问题 经过了几年的经历,使用过包括VC++6.0.VS2010旗舰版.VS2013旗舰版.Code::Blocks 16.01.Dev-C++ ...

  7. QT for symbian 开发环境安装

    Qt for Symbian 的开发环境主要由三部分组成:基本工具;Symbian SDK;Qt for Symbian SDK.请依序安装. 注意1: 如果在Nokia 论坛上下载开发工具,你需要你 ...

  8. Linux上的集成开发环境

    随着Linux的逐渐兴起,已经有为数众多的程序在上面驰骋了,许多开发环境(Development Environment)也应运而生.好的开发环境一定是集成了编辑.编译和调试等多项功能并且易于使用.本 ...

  9. windows和linux在建筑python集成开发环境IDE

    http://blog.csdn.net/pipisorry/article/details/39854707 使用的系统及软件 Ubuntu / windows Python 2.7 / pytho ...

最新文章

  1. css3替代图片的尖角圆角效果
  2. 你们觉得这个时代好还是父母那个时代好?
  3. APScheduler——定时任务框架
  4. 背包之01背包、完全背包、多重背包详解
  5. 制图折断线_机械制图的截断线与折断线的区别是什么?
  6. CentOS7 VMware虚拟机克隆 网卡无法启动问题解决
  7. 云服务器无限多开一个软件吗,只需要一个神器就能无限多开微信!
  8. VOA 2009年11月23日 星期一 这里是美国——感恩节对美国人来说意味着什么
  9. Mac下使用Mounty挂载NTFS出现了文件不能拷贝的解决办法
  10. 今日全国油价查询2022-03-08
  11. 前同事被裁员,股票清零!
  12. python tableau工作流_【干货】五分钟Get到Tableau五个实用小技巧
  13. 机器学习_评价指标Accuracy(准确率)、Precision(精准度/查准率)、Recall(召回率/查全率)、F1 Scores详解
  14. Mybatis学习笔记_5、Mybatis动态SQL
  15. 【机器学习】Scikit-Learn数据预处理文档翻译+笔记记录 - 1
  16. LINUX信息安全系统设计基础第一周学习总结
  17. 怎么在windows桌面添加便签
  18. GPT3.5插件免费使用方法(无须科学上网)
  19. python自动化库_Python操作自动化库PyAutoGUI的方法
  20. 设备软件控制平台会是什么样子?

热门文章

  1. 将ocx和DLL文件打包成cab文件,inf的编写
  2. Android开发之Handler
  3. TCPDUMP/LIBPCAP 3-PCAP 中文手册(1)
  4. [react] 请说说什么是useReducer?
  5. [react] react中调用setState会更新的生命周期有哪几个?
  6. React开发(201):react代码分割之打包导出
  7. 前端学习(3206):初始化state
  8. [js] AudioContext有什么应用场景?
  9. [js] promise的构造函数是同步执行还是异步执行,它的then方法呢?
  10. 前端学习(2841):UI开发思路--搭建架子